Twain, California

Twain, California is your go-to destination for top outdoor adventures. Among the must-visit attractions is the Pacific Crest Trail, a challenging hike that rewards you with stunning views of the Sierra Nevada and Cascade mountain ranges. The trail features unique rock formations and a variety of flora and fauna. If you prefer water activities, Feather River is nearby, offering opportunities for fishing and rafting. For a more relaxed outdoor activity, you can enjoy a picnic by the beautiful Lake Almanor, surrounded by scenic views of lush greenery. Don't miss a trip to the Lassen Volcanic National Park, home to steaming fumaroles and clear mountain lakes. Explore the best Trails and Outdoor Activities in and near Twain for a memorable trip.

Top Spots in and near Twain